Sports Leagues
See allBig Apple Dodgeball
Big Apple Dodgeball is NYC’s premier LGBTQ+ social dodgeball league. Open to all abilities, this high-energy co-ed league emphasizes sportsmanship and community, with seasonal tournaments and social events .
Big Apple Kickball
Big Apple Kickball is NYC’s premier LGBTQ+ social kickball league, open to all skill levels. Participants play the fun, nostalgic game of kickball outdoors and meet new friends in a supportive environment .
Big Apple Softball
Founded in 1977, the Big Apple Softball League is a historic New York LGBTQ+ softball league offering both competitive and recreational divisions, with over 600 members .
BLAZE Backpacking
BLAZE (Backpacking Gay Men of NYC) is an outdoors group for gay men who love adventure. They organize backpacking, hiking, and camping trips around New York and beyond for members seeking active outdoor experiences .
Community Groups
See allACT UP New York
A diverse, nonpartisan group committed to direct action to end the AIDS crisis. Formed in 1987 in response to government negligence and medical establishment complacency during the HIV/AIDS epidemic.
Ali Forney Center
Founded in 2002, the Ali Forney Center is the nation's largest organization dedicated to homeless LGBTQ+ youth. Their mission is to protect LGBTQ+ young people from the harms of homelessness and empower them to live independently.
Bronx Academy of Arts and Dance (BAAD!)
A Bronx-based performing and visual art workshop space co-founded by Arthur Aviles and Charles Rice-Gonzales. Focuses on works exploring the margins of Latino and LGBTQ cultures through dance, visual art, and performance.
Brooklyn Community Pride Center
Advances LGBTQ+ liberation in Brooklyn through socially conscious and culturally responsive events, programs, partnerships, and advocacy. Serves the community from young people to elders.
